Transaction d60b9daf7ca4725f5a573d6cab9d2fb5d60dd2ec18dded35322f26d03d07f633
1 Input
1 Outputs
- d60b9daf7ca4725f5a573d6cab9d2fb5d60dd2ec18dded35322f26d03d07f633:0
value 2350820
address 3PSCEJLjUzjaXxyBcq2LfMa1ukEB7yJmYU